Scientific Name: Azolla pinnata

Print This Page
  • Pronunciation:
    az-OLL-ah pin-NA-ta
  • Common Name:
    Ferny Azolla
  • Type:
  • Family:
    SALVINIACEAE
  • Status:
    Common
  • Flowers:
    Ferns do not have flowers or fruit but produce spores on the backs of their leaves throughout the year.
  • Flowers Color:
    N/A
  • Fruit Color:
    N/A
  • Vegetation Type:
    Freshwater wetlands. Usually found in still water in full sun.

Identification Notes

Branching brittle stems are hidden by scale-like leaves. Can be red or green.
